统一消息推送平台与Python的集成操作手册
2025-10-20 07:10
在现代软件系统中,统一消息推送平台作为关键组件,承担着信息传递与通知管理的职责。结合Python语言的灵活性和丰富的库支持,开发者可以高效地构建和维护此类平台。
本操作手册旨在指导开发者如何使用Python实现统一消息推送平台的基本功能。首先,需安装必要的依赖库,如`requests`用于HTTP请求,`pika`用于AMQP协议的消息队列交互。以下为示例代码:
import requests def send_message(message): url = "https://api.pushplatform.com/send" payload = {"message": message} response = requests.post(url, json=payload) return response.status_code
此代码片段展示了通过REST API向统一消息推送平台发送消息的基本方法。此外,对于基于消息队列的推送机制,可使用如下代码:
import pika def publish_message(queue_name, message): connection = pika.BlockingConnection(pika.ConnectionParameters('localhost')) channel = connection.channel() channel.queue_declare(queue=queue_name) channel.basic_publish(exchange='', routing_key=queue_name, body=message) connection.close()
上述代码演示了如何将消息发布到RabbitMQ等消息队列中,以便后续处理并推送到目标设备或用户。
在实际部署中,还需考虑身份验证、错误处理、日志记录等细节。建议开发者结合具体业务需求,扩展上述基础功能,以实现更完善的消息推送服务。
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!
标签:统一消息推送平台